Home Foundation Leveling in Wake Forest, NC
Home foundation leveling services involve adjusting and stabilizing a building’s foundation to correct uneven settling or shifting. This process is commonly used for residential properties experiencing issues such as cracked walls, uneven floors, or doors and windows that no longer close properly. Projects typically include lifting and supporting the foundation, filling in voids, and ensuring the structure is properly aligned to prevent further damage. Home Foundation Leveling Questions
What causes foundation settling? Foundation settling can result from soil movement, moisture changes, or poor initial construction, leading to uneven support for the structure.
How can I tell if my foundation needs leveling? Signs include visible cracks in walls or floors, uneven flooring, or doors and windows that don’t close properly.
What types of foundation leveling methods are available? Common methods include mudjacking and piering, which stabilize and lift the foundation to restore proper alignment.
Is foundation leveling necessary for all types of damage? Foundation leveling is typically recommended when there are noticeable shifts or unevenness that affect the stability of the property.
